草庐IT

CMAKE_C_COMPILER

全部标签

在用cmake编译时,遇到opencv报错runtime library

错误描述CMakeWarningatCMakeLists.txt:123(add_executable):Cannotgenerateasaferuntimesearchpathfortargetmono_eurocbecausefilesinsomedirectoriesmayconflictwithlibrariesinimplicitdirectories:runtimelibrary[libopencv_stitching.so.4.2]in/usr/lib/x86_64-linux-gnumaybehiddenbyfilesin:/usr/local/libruntimelibrar

CMake快速使用+VSCode开发(调试)

CMake学习使用1、cmake安装和入门使用1.1安装sudoaptinstallcmake #即可安装cmake-version#查看安装的cmake版本1.2简单程序使用cmake在指定的目录中作为项目目录,里面只有一个Apply.cpp文件。此外为了使用cmake,需要有一个CMakeLists.txt文件。内容如下:在项目目录中创建一个build文件夹,然后进入该目录进行命令的操作。如下:此时,有了Makefile文件,然后可以使用make命令来生成可执行程序app,如下:最后可以使用app来执行程序。如果需要删除app可执行文件,可以使用makeclean然后app就会被清理掉,再

CMake:构建类型(Debug、Release以及其他)

@TOC导言我们前几篇的学习基本上可以完整构建项目和库了,接下来我们将基于第三篇的内容进行修改和补充,不断的完善各种学到的内容。基本概念构建类型CMake可以识别的构建类型是:Debug:用于在没有优化的情况下,使用带有调试符号构建库或者可执行文件Release:用于构建的优化的库或者可执行文件,不包含调试符号RelWithDebInfo:用于构建较少的优化库或者可执行文件,包含调试符号MinSizeRel:用于不增加目标代码大小的优化方式,来构建库或者可执行文件控制生成构建系统使用的配置变量是CMAKE_BUILD_TYPE,该变量默认为空。这里我们仍然选择CMake第三篇—动态库和静态库的

【CMake】Visual Studio CMake 教程 vs-cmake-examples

项目链接:cmake-examples01BasicAHelloCMake目标:CMake基本框架使用VisualStudio打开构建的项目CMakeList.txt#设置最小的CMake版本#可以通过命令查询环境中cmake的版本cmake--versioncmake_minimum_required(VERSION3.0)#设置项目名称project(hello_cmake)#添加一个可执行程序add_executable(hello_cmake"main.cpp")编译创建Build目录并进入Build目录执行cmake..使用使用visualstudio打开.sln文件,并编译。B添加

CMake Error: The source directory “XXX“ does not appear to contain CMakeLists.txt

CMakeError:Thesourcedirectory“XXX”doesnotappeartocontainCMakeLists.txt正常CMakeLists.txt文件是在项目根目录下,而我们在项目的build文件夹中进行cmake,导致找不到文件,解决方法,命令行后加两个点表示上级目录,关键就是这两个点:cmake-DCMAKE_BUILD_TYPE:STRING=Release-DGKFS_BUILD_TESTS:BOOL=ON..

android - 启用语言后 CMake 错误 : CMAKE_C_COMPILER not set,

当我构建一个包含ndk代码的android项目时。我收到以下错误:Buildcommandfailed.Errorwhileexecutingprocess/home/gongzelong/Android/Sdk/cmake/3.6.4111459/bin/cmakewitharguments{-H/media/gongzelong/TOSHIBA/Code/Code/ImageLoaderEncapsulation/ImageLoader/ImageLoaderDemo/app-B/media/gongzelong/TOSHIBA/Code/Code/ImageLoaderEncap

ASIC设计学习笔记——使用Design Compiler进行综合

文章目录前言1.基本概念1.1综合(Synthesis)1.2使用DesignCompiler进行综合2.使用DC进行编译2.1进入DC环境2.2编译过程2.2.1设置搜索路径2.2.2库环境设置2.2.3编译参数配置2.2.4读入设计2.2.5编译命令2.2.6保存编译结果2.2.6.1输出文件格式说明2.2.6.2保存报告2.3其他常用命令2.4完整脚本4.可能遇到的问题和解决方案4.1Net‘Q’oradirectlyconnectednetisdrivenbymorethanonesource,andnotalldriversarethree-state.(ELAB-366)4.2ve

android - 警告 : This class was probably produced by a broken compiler

我已经将Jacson库添加到我的android项目中,现在我在控制台中收到这样的警告:warning:IgnoringInnerClassesattributeforananonymousinnerclassthatdoesn'tcomewithanassociatedEnclosingMethodattribute.(Thisclasswasprobablyproducedbyabrokencompiler.)我试过重新编译库,但没用。当我从项目中删除这些库时,警告消失了。设备上一切正常,但这让我很烦;)你知道什么解决办法吗?我正在使用Eclipse。 最

【QtQuick3D学习】初探数字人,使用Qt Design Studio导入Blender模型,并驱动形态键Shape Key——基于C++和Cmake

初探数字人,使用QtDesignStudio导入Blender模型,并驱动形态键ShapeKey——基于C++和CmakeBlenderQtDesignStudio运行结果Blender首先使用Blender创建数字人模型,然后导出为fbx格式没有模型的可以下载文章上方资源,或者直接点击下方链接下载数字人demo模型fbxQtDesignStudio然后使用QtDesignStudio创建demo工程,得到下面的运行结果然后左下角切换到Assets窗口,点击+符号,导入从Blender导出的模型导入成功后,可以切换到Components窗口,看到多出来的MY3DCOMPONENTS中有导入的模

[Visual Studio C盘找不到VC/Bin文件]nvcc fatal : Cannot find compiler ‘cl.exe‘ in PATH

前言在用nvcc文件编译CUDA程序(.cu文件)时候报了以下错误:nvccfatal:Cannotfindcompiler‘cl.exe‘inPATH该问题是因为系统找不到cl.exe文件网上都说是要将C:\ProgramFiles\MicrosoftVisualStudio10.0\VC\bin文件目录加入到环境变量中,但我在电脑里找不到该目录。经过一番查找发现,新版本的visualstudio的cl.exe文件在自己的安装目录下:I:\IDE\VisualStudio\VSIDE\VC\Tools\MSVC\14.37.32822\bin\Hostx64\x64将该目录加入系统环境变量P